‘Never Mind the Polar Bears, What Will WE Eat? ‘Public meeting on Arctic meltdown and global food supply at Pakistan Community Centre, Marley Walk, Station Parade, Willesden Green, NW2 4PU (just behind Willesden Green tube station).

November 21, 2012 from 7:30pm to 9:30pm
Meeting organised by Brent Campaign against Climate Change and Brent Friends of the Earth, with expert speakers, followed by discussion. The meeting will cover the latest scientific evidence  and how the rapid disappearance of the Arctic ice cap affects food prices in Britain and the risk of further floods and droughts in other parts of the world.Phil Thornhill,National  Co-ordinator of Campaign against Climate Change, will review the latest scientific evidence of the depletion of Arctic ice…See More

Transition Willesden 'Transition 2.0' Film and Discussion at St Mungo's, 115 Pound Lane, Willesden, NW10 2HU (opposite Willesden bus garage)

October 22, 2012 from 7:30pm to 9:30pm
Find out more about the Transition movement and what groups like ours are doing in communities in towns and cities across the world, where people are taking action to reconnect with food, helping their local economy and even setting up community power stations.  The film features Transition Kensal to Kilburn’s tube station allotment. We’ll also have a slide show about what Transition Willesden has done so far, and a discussion to develop future activities.Free event.  Refreshments available. …See More
